DAI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2017 in Review

25 of the 4,409 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in DAIMLER AG (DAI) for Q4 2017, worth a combined $27.1M — down 0.25% from $27.1M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 5 funds opened new DAI positions and 3 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 3 added to existing stakes and 7 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Gardner Russo & Quinn, opening a new position worth an estimated $77K. The largest seller was North Star Asset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$447K sold.
